Wraps. Condition: Good to Very Good-. Vol. I, No. 4. Edited by John W. Campbell, Jr. Cover art by Graves Gladney for "Flame Winds" (novel) by Norvell W. Page. Includes "Don't Go Haunting" (novelette) by Robert Coley; "The Gnarly Man" (novelette) by L. Sprague de Camp; "The Right Ear of Malchus" by J. Allan Dunn; "The Summons" by Don Evans; Parole" by Thomas Calvert McClary; "The Hexer" by H. W. Guernsey [Howard Wandrei]. Readers' Department: "Of Things Beyond"; "-And Having Writ-". Illustrated by Cartier, Gilmore, Kirchner, Mayan, and Orban. Creasing; tears at spine ends; standard wear and tear at edges and corners; marks on front. Magazine.
